The Adtec Phakic IOL Family represents a new standard in refractive correction for high myopia.
Designed for implantation without altering the eye’s natural crystalline structure, these lenses offer high refractive accuracy, superior optical quality, and rapid visual recovery — enabling surgeons to achieve stable outcomes with minimal invasiveness.
The Adtec Multi features a double aspheric optic engineered for exceptional visual performance at both near and distance.
These lenses incorporate a natural yellow chromophore that offers balanced photoprotection across the UV and violet spectrum without compromising colour perception— delivering patient satisfaction with minimal dysphotopsia.
The Adtec Mono EDOF IOL provides an extended depth of focus with remarkable image quality and contrast sensitivity.
Designed for surgeons who value precision and flexibility, it reduces spectacle dependence for intermediate tasks — making it ideal for active patients seeking Intermediate vision without compromising distance clarity.
The Adtec Trifocal EDOF unites the strengths of trifocal and EDOF optics to deliver smooth, continuous vision from 32 cm to infinity
Engineered for visual independence, it provides crisp intermediate and distance performance with excellent neuroadaptation — making it a surgeon’s preferred choice for premium cataract patients.
The Adtec Trifocal IOL delivers seamless vision across near, intermediate, and far distances with natural visual transitions.
Its optical design minimises halos and glare while enhancing contrast, making it ideal for cataract patients who desire complete spectacle independence and comfort in all lighting conditions.
The Adtec Monofocal IOL offers superior clarity, contrast, and centration for distance vision.
Built for reliability and ease of implantation, this IOL remains the gold standard for surgeons seeking simplicity, precision, and long-term stability for their patients.
The Adtec Advanced Monofocal IOL bridges the gap between standard Monofocal and EDOF technology.
Its enhanced aspheric profile improves intermediate vision while maintaining excellent distance focus — offering surgeons a versatile solution for patients desiring extended functionality with Monofocal comfort.
The Adtec Toric Family is crafted with nanoform precision technology to ensure exact spherical and cylindrical power alignment.
Our patented Adtec Lock Haptic Design provides auto-centration, high capsular stability, and minimal postoperative rotation, ensuring consistent refractive accuracy and predictable outcomes — even in complex astigmatic cases.
